Objectives

To understand about the tangent and its relationship to the circle

Estimated Time

30 minutes

Prerequisites/Instructions, prior preparations, if any

Knowledge about Circle, radius, angle

Materials/ Resources needed

Digital: Click here to open the file

Non-digital:Paper, pencil, ruler, compass, protractor.

Process (How to do the activity)

Procedure:

  1. 'A' is the center of the circle
  2. What are 'AD' and 'AE' with respect to the circle?
  3. What type of angles are ∠BDA and ∠BEA ?
  4. In any circle the radius drawn at the point of contact is perpendicular to the tangent. ∠BDA = ∠BEA = 90
  5. We can draw two tangents to a circle from a point outside the circle
  6. Name the tangents drawn from the external point B to the circle
  7. Measure AD and AE. What is your conclusions?
  8. What type of triangles are BDA and BEA ?
  9. What is AB with respect to triangle BDA and BEA ?
  10. Are triangle BDA and BEA congruent to each other?
  11. The tangent drawn from an external point to a circle a] are equal b] subtend equal angle at the centre c] are equally inclined to the line joining the centre and external point.
  12. Properties of quadrilateral (sum of all angles) is 360 degrees
  13. Angle between the two tangents from a point outside the circle is supplementary to the angle subtended by the line segments joining points of contact at the centre.

Evaluation at the end of activity

Tangents AP and AQ are drawn to circle with centre 'O', from an external point 'A'.Prove that ∠PAQ=2∠OPQ
